    If you are not familiar with the orca attacks (interactions) -- since 2020 the Orca's around the Spanish and Portuguese Coast have been 'playing' with sailboats, biting off rudders and unfortunately, in some instances, boats have been sunk. So, not ideal when your sailboat is also your full time home!

    What do you do with the sand?

    • @SailingIndiana
      @SailingIndiana  Месяц назад

      Good question!
      It’s a trick the local fishermen have used for some time, to keep the orca away from fishing nets and their tuna. You chuck some sand overboard and, apparently, it disorientates the orca and they back off!
      There have been numerous reports from sailors who have tried it and said it worked.
      We’ll try anything we can to keep our rudder intact😂🤞🏼
